Default 01 pinion upgrade pdeload too tight

I have an 01 Ram 1500 that had 4.10 gears that I am upgrading to 4.56. I installed the new pinion and all new bearings all seemed ok I torqued unti I got 15 inch pounds but the pinion is so tight I could barely turn the pinion. I went ahead and put the carrier in and got the proper backlash set but sill seemed that eveything was too tight still so I took apart and installed a new crush sleeve to try again thinking I over tightened the pinion with the same result. I compared the original sleeve to the new one I replaced they were almost identical. I am assuming I should be able to turn the pinion by hand when I have the proper preload. Any idea's or comments?
